Ok. So, I purchased my Anovos Standard Han Solo Bespin ensemble from a private seller who wore it once and decided he looked like a fool because of his body type and lack of hair. He sold it to me at below-cost. I already had the holster from a previous order with Anovos.
With that being said, despite my bad relationship with and feelings towards Anovos, their product--at least the cloth and leathers that I've had from them--are simply outstanding. They are very well made and fit and drape just like the screen-used ensemble. The Jacket is the correct blue hue, though I wish I had the premiere jacket. The only thing I can see about the jacket that strikes me as odd is the left sleeve rectangular pocket flap. It seems awfully narrow compared to all the others I've seen.
The shirt material is actually quite substantial and the fit is great. Not too baggy at all. But it doesn't seem to drape as lazily as the premiere shirt would have. Two of the four snaps on one side were hanging off by a thread and I had to reattach them. One thing I do wish is, that they'd have put the invisible snaps all the way down the front of the shirt instead of only 3/4 of the way down because the shirt separates, then pulls on the top snaps as you move around, sometimes unsnapping them.
The pants were shorter than I'd expected, but not in a way that affected their wear. I was just hoping for full-length so I could find other creative ways to wear them in their down-time. They are the premiere pants, so the materials and design and fit are all very accurate. The one thing I wish were different, otherwise, is I wish the elastic bands used for stirrups were adjustable. I had to remove them and redo them with adjustable straps because, as they shipped, they constantly and significantly fought to pull my britches clean off! Once I got that adjusted right, the whole ensemble fit and felt as if I were wearing normal clothes you'd buy off the rack (with the exception of the constant slight downward tug of the elastic stirrups on my pants).
Overall, I think Anovos's Han Solo Bespin ensemble is the best on the market and well worth the purchase price, provided it's in stock.
Now. Magnoli Clothiers. I like Magnoli's quality and customer service. Love it, actually. I also like the man. He seems a good person. That makes it hard to give my honest review, but here goes.
Magnoli also makes respectable Han Bespin ensemble pieces, but there are some minor differences in both appearance and fit that ultimately steered me back to Anovos's offerings. At one time, I owned their Jacket, Shirt, and Pants, but sold the them.
The first thing I have to say about Magnoli's is that they custom-tailor your clothes. I found the feeling of tailored clothes to be restrictive and slightly uncomfortable, especially in the pants where I'm not used to butt-hugging pants. The pants were GREAT, and full-length with full-length blood stripes, but I couldn't handle how they fit.
The jacket was nice, but the pocket dimensions and how they look was just slightly off. I think the top pockets on the front are too narrow and the back pocket is too large. Also, the collar was just too tall. This opinion is validated by the Anovos jacket, whose collar is notably shorter. The small difference in height translates to a noticeable difference in how it looks when worn.
Finally, the shirt. I just couldn't get to like the shirt, even after my talks with Magnoli helped lead to a shirt redesign. The material I ordered it in was too much like a dress shirt and didn't drape like the material Anovos uses for their ensembles--Standard or Premium. Additionally, although they look similar, the construction on the Magnoli shirt is different than the screen used shirt in that the shirt only separates until the bottom of the flat, where the rest is material all the way around. It made the shirt ride up funny and bloom at the top, which I wasn't fond of.
Again, Magnoli's quality and customer service are beyond reproach. It's the small differences in appearance and fit in the eyes of a perfectionist that ultimately led to me going with Anovos's offering.
